About United States Copper Index Fund

CPER is a commodity ETF that tracks the price of copper futures via the SummerHaven Copper Index. It provides direct exposure to the 'red metal' using a rules-based strategy to select futures contracts, making it a key tool for hedging or betting on industrial growth and electrification.

About Rigetti Computing Inc

Rigetti Computing, Inc. is a pioneer in quantum computing, focusing on developing and deploying quantum-classical computing systems. The company designs and fabricates superconducting quantum processors and integrates them with a full-stack software and control platform. Rigetti offers access to its quantum computers through the cloud, aiming to solve complex computational problems that are intractable for classical computers, with applications in finance, chemistry, and machine learning.
